From 258822f10abfe3ce6278487424b682cf029ee77f Mon Sep 17 00:00:00 2001 From: Urban Müller Date: Mon, 4 Feb 2008 13:47:26 +0000 Subject: debug code for lastsent --- it.class |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) (limited to 'it.class') diff --git a/it.class b/it.class index 10cede4..083ca51 100644 --- a/it.class +++ b/it.class @@ -173,7 +173,11 @@ function error($p = array(), $body = null, $to = null) # $body and $to deprecate if ($sendmail) { $lastsentfn = "/tmp/alertdata/lastsent_" . getmyuid() . "." . md5($p['to']); - if (($sendmail = time() - @filemtime($lastsentfn) > $p['blockmail'])) + $now = time(); + $lastsenttime = @filemtime($lastsentfn); + $sendmail = $now - $lastsenttime > $p['blockmail']; + $lastsentdebug = "Lastsent: lastsentfn=$lastsentfn now=$now lastsenttime=$lastsenttime blockmail={$p['blockmail']} sendmail=$sendmail\n\n"; + if ($sendmail) { @unlink($lastsentfn); @touch($lastsentfn); @@ -200,6 +204,7 @@ function error($p = array(), $body = null, $to = null) # $body and $to deprecate $body .= "Host: " . getenv('HOSTNAME') . "\n\n"; $body .= $p['locals'] && strlen($locals) < 100000 ? "Locals: $locals\n\n" : ""; $body .= $p['id'] ? "Filter: graceperiod={$p['graceperiod']} timewindow={$p['timewindow']}\n\n" : ""; + $body .= $lastsentdebug; $body .= $_GET ? "\$_GET: " . print_r($_GET, true) . "\n\n" : ""; $body .= $_POST ? "\$_POST: " . print_r($_POST, true) . "\n\n" : ""; $body .= $_COOKIE ? "\$_COOKIE: " . print_r($_COOKIE, true) . "\n\n" : ""; -- cgit v1.2.3